Understanding Indoor Air Quality

Indoor air quality (IAQ) is crucial for the health and productivity of employees. Poor IAQ can lead to a range of health issues, including headaches, fatigue, asthma, and other respiratory problems. Elements that contribute to poor IAQ include dust, moisture, volatile organic compounds (VOCs), and inadequate ventilation. One efficient, eco-friendly solution to enhance IAQ is incorporating indoor plants into office spaces.

The Science Behind Plants and Air Quality

Plants have a unique ability to absorb carbon dioxide and release oxygen via photosynthesis. However, their impact goes beyond simply improving oxygen levels. Certain plants can absorb specific VOCs and particulate matter, thus enhancing air quality significantly.

Top Office Plants for Air Quality Improvement

Selecting the right plants for your office can be challenging. Here’s a list of some of the best office plants renowned for their ability to purify the air:

1. Spider Plant (Chlorophytum comosum)

  • Benefits: Spider plants are known to remove pollutants like formaldehyde and xylene from the air.
  • Light Requirements: They thrive in bright, indirect light but are also adaptable to lower light conditions.
  • Care Tips: Water them well but allow the soil to dry between waterings to prevent root rot.

2. Peace Lily (Spathiphyllum spp.)

  • Benefits: Peace lilies effectively filter out benzene, formaldehyde, and ammonia.
  • Light Requirements: They prefer low to medium, indirect light.
  • Care Tips: Keep the soil moist and mist the leaves regularly to maintain humidity.

3. Snake Plant (Sansevieria trifasciata)

  • Benefits: This hardy plant can convert CO2 into oxygen at night, making it unique among plants.
  • Light Requirements: Thrives in a variety of light conditions, including low light.
  • Care Tips: Water sparingly, as they are tolerant of drought.

4. Rubber Plant (Ficus elastica)

  • Benefits: Rubber plants can absorb formaldehyde and purify the air effectively.
  • Light Requirements: They like bright, indirect light, though they can tolerate lower light levels.
  • Care Tips: Water when the top inch of soil feels dry.

5. Boston Fern (Nephrolepis exaltata)

  • Benefits: Known for its ability to absorb formaldehyde and other toxins; it also increases humidity.
  • Light Requirements: Prefers indirect light with high humidity.
  • Care Tips: Keep the soil consistently moist and mist regularly.

6. Bamboo Palm (Chamaedorea seifrizii)

  • Benefits: This palm is great at filtering out benzene and formaldehyde.
  • Light Requirements: Prefers partial shade and can tolerate lower light conditions.
  • Care Tips: Water regularly to keep the soil slightly moist.

7. ZZ Plant (Zamioculcas zamiifolia)

  • Benefits: It is known for its ability to survive low light and drought while filtering toxins.
  • Light Requirements: Thrives in low light conditions.
  • Care Tips: Water the plant when the soil is completely dry.

8. Areca Palm (Dypsis lutescens)

  • Benefits: Great for humidifying the air and removing toxins like xylene and formaldehyde.
  • Light Requirements: Prefers bright, indirect light.
  • Care Tips: Water regularly to keep the soil moist without overwatering.

9. Pothos (Epipremnum aureum)

  • Benefits: Known for its ability to filter formaldehyde, benzene, and xylene.
  • Light Requirements: Adaptable, does well in a range of lighting conditions.
  • Care Tips: Allow the soil to dry a bit between waterings.

10. Dracaena (Dracaena spp.)

  • Benefits: Effective in removing VOCs, especially formaldehyde and benzene.
  • Light Requirements: Prefers moderate light.
  • Care Tips: Water when the leaves start to droop.

Creating an Optimal Office Plant Environment

While choosing the right plants is crucial, the environment in which they are placed also affects their air-purifying capabilities.

Light Considerations

Different plants have varying light requirements. When selecting plants, consider the natural light availability in your office. Offices with large windows may benefit from light-loving plants, while those with minimal light can opt for low-light tolerant species.

Plant Placement

Strategically placing plants throughout the office can maximize their air-purifying effects. Consider placing plants near workstations, conference rooms, and reception areas. The visual benefits of plants also contribute positively to the overall aesthetic and mood of the workplace.

Maintenance and Care

Regular maintenance of plants is essential for their growth and air-purifying capabilities. Regular watering, pruning dead leaves, and repotting when necessary will ensure that plants thrive. Challenges of Office Plant Care

While there are numerous benefits to introducing plants into the office, challenges can arise, especially in a commercial setting.

Limited Natural Light

An office with limited natural light can pose challenges for certain plant species. However, many low-light plants are resilient and can still thrive in such conditions. Consider using grow lights to supplement natural light.

Employee Allergies

Some employees may have allergies to specific plants or soil types. It’s essential to consider these factors when selecting plants for the office. Non-flowering plants are generally better for allergy sufferers.

Space Limitations

In smaller offices, space can be a constraint. Vertical gardening solutions, wall-mounted planters, and strategic placement of small plants can help maximize the greenery without the need for extensive horizontal space.

Innovative Plant Solutions

Vertical Gardens

Vertical gardens, also known as living walls, are becoming increasingly popular in office settings. They effectively use space and provide significant air-purifying benefits.

Hydroponics and Aquaponics

For offices keen on sustainability, hydroponics and aquaponics offer innovative ways to cultivate plants without soil. This technique reduces the risk of pests and simplifies maintenance.

Smart Plant Care Systems

With the rise of technology, smart systems for plant care are becoming viable options for offices. Automated watering systems and apps to monitor plant health can ease the commitment to maintaining office plants.

Air Quality Monitoring

In addition to incorporating office plants, organizations should consider investing in air quality monitoring systems. These devices can measure levels of CO2, VOCs, humidity, and particulate matter, helping to track improvements and ensure a healthy work environment.
